Visual Basic - consulta de fechas

Life is soft - evento anual de software empresarial
 
Vista:

consulta de fechas

Publicado por Esther (5 intervenciones) el 29/09/2003 18:23:25
Hola a todos, necesito realizar una consulta que me borre los registros que tengan fecha de 28 días atras, he probado varias formas pero no me funciona, si alguien me puede ayudar, gracias !!
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:consulta de fechas

Publicado por gustavo (15 intervenciones) el 29/09/2003 19:11:11
no especificaste en que motor, si es en access es asi

db.Execute ("Delete Tarjetas.* FROM Tarjetas WHERE Lote = #2008/05/05#")

te aconsejo que siempre manejes las fechas YYYY/MM/DD
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:consulta de fechas

Publicado por Juan (284 intervenciones) el 29/09/2003 19:19:53
Prueba con esto:

SQLText = "DELETE * FROM tabla WHERE campoFecha <= #" & Format(DateAdd("d",-28,date),"m/d/aaaa") & "#"

No lo he probado así que deberías verificar que la expresión Format(DateAdd("d",-28,date),"m/d/aaaa") devuelve la fecha que es 28 dias anterior a la actual.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ar